Original Description
The iconic Bucking Bronco With Cowboy by John Edward Borein (1872–1945) captures the raw energy and unbridled spirit of the American West. Known for his authentic depictions of cowboy life, Borein—a self-taught artist closely associated with the Taos Society of Artists—infuses this piece with dynamic brushstrokes and earthy tones, embodying the rugged realism of early 20th-century Western art. The painting throbs with motion: the cowboy clings to the bucking horse, their forms taut with tension against an atmospheric, unadorned backdrop. Borein’s firsthand experience as a cowboy lends striking accuracy to the scene, making it a vital document of frontier culture. This work exemplifies his ability to distill adrenaline and tradition onto canvas, securing his legacy as a key chronicler of the West’s mythic era alongside peers like Frederic Remington and Charles M. Russell.
